PER CURIAM.
This case involves a foreclosure action instituted in January, 1976. On December 2, 1977, the court rendered a judgment ordering foreclosure by sale, from which the named defendant (hereinafter the defendant) appealed to this court. On July 24, 1979, this court concluded that no error had been committed by the trial court and remanded the case to it to set a new date for a public sale of the mortgaged premises.
